Enacted in August 2022, the Inflation Reduction Act expanded energy tax credits significantly by increasing credit amounts and broadening eligibility criteria to include new technologies. The Act allows firms to develop and sell energy tax credits, offering reassurance to industry participants concerned about the future of energy tax credits. Treasury and the IRS released final regulations for technology-neutral electricity tax credits in January 2025, providing guidance on qualifying clean energy investments. Bonus credits are available for projects in low-income communities, using domestically manufactured components, or meeting wage and apprenticeship requirements. The regulations aim to support the development of clean energy projects through various incentives. Furthermore, the regulations outline paths for innovative processes and clarify requirements for qualifying technologies, including hydrogen energy storage. Additional updates in 2025 introduce a Clean Hydrogen Credit, bonus credits for projects benefiting low-income communities, proposed rules for clean vehicle tax credits, and guidance on producing sustainable aviation fuel. These updates highlight the government's efforts to promote clean energy investments, support domestic production, and incentivize innovation in emerging technologies.
